What services are available at OU Edmond Medical Center?
OU Edmond Medical Center offers a wide array of services, tailored to meet the diverse healthcare needs of the Edmond community. While a complete list is best found on their official website (avoiding direct links as requested), we can highlight some key areas:
- Primary Care: This forms the foundation of their services, offering routine checkups, preventative care, and management of chronic conditions. Think of it as your healthcare home base.
- Specialty Care: They boast a network of specialists, meaning you can often find the expertise you need without having to travel far from home. This could include cardiology, oncology, orthopedics, and more.
- Diagnostic Imaging: Modern diagnostic tools, including X-rays, CT scans, and MRIs, are readily available to assist in accurate diagnoses.
- Emergency Services: In urgent situations, the center provides immediate care and stabilization before transfer to a larger facility if necessary.
The exact range of services can fluctuate, so checking their website for the most current information is always recommended.

Does OU Edmond Medical Center have an emergency room?
While a full-fledged, Level I trauma center may not be available at the Edmond location, they do offer urgent care services and emergency stabilization. For truly life-threatening emergencies, it’s crucial to dial 911 or proceed directly to a hospital equipped to handle major trauma. The center's staff is well-trained to assess the urgency of a situation and guide patients appropriately.
